Elmhurst University seeks part-time faculty to join the vibrant professional teaching and learning community in First-Year Writing during fall term 2026. All first-year writing courses meet in person in computer-assisted writing labs. Enrollment in first-year writing courses is generally capped at 18 students.
Position Status: Exempt
Salary Range: The pay range is $3,800-$4,000 for a standard 1.0 credit (4 semester hour) course. New part-time faculty start at $3,800 (Adjunct Level 1).
Work Location: This position is
ineligible for remote work.
Responsibilities
Responsibilities include teaching 1 to 3 sections of Composition I and/or II, including in-person instruction and regular assessment of student learning outcomes. Additionally, ENG 200: Introduction to Literature may also be a possible course to teach, pending availability.
Successful candidates will demonstrate a commitment to excellence in undergraduate teaching. Responsibilities for this adjunct faculty position include course preparation including syllabus development, teaching, grading and being available to students who have questions or require extra help.
